Most of the high explosives, permitted explosives and slurry explosives used in the mines have a velocity of detonation ranging between 2500 and 5000 metres per second. For high explosives which are used as boosters, the V.O.D. is high, e.g. O.C.G. - 6000 m/s; Primer - 7000 m/s.

Uranium Ore (Carnotite). Milling: This process takes place at a mill after the ore containing uranium is removed from the Earth through open pit or underground mining.The ore is brought to a mill, crushed, and ground up before chemicals are added to dissolve the uranium. The uranium is then separated from the chemical solution, solidified, dried and packaged.

AngloGold Ashanti 's Mponeng gold mine, located south-west of Johannesburg in South Africa, is currently the deepest mine in the world. The operating depth at Mponeng mine ranged from between 3.16km to 3.84km below the surface by the end of 2018. Ongoing expansions are expected to extend the operating depth further to 4.27km.

3. Processing Chemicals Pollution. This kind of pollution occurs when chemical agents (such as cyanide or sulphuric acid used by mining companies to separate the target mineral from the ore) spill, leak, or leach from the mine site into nearby water bodies. Mining activities increase the volume and rate of exposure of sulfur-containing rocks to air and water, creating sulfuric acid and dissolved iron. This acid run-off dissolves heavy metals such as copper, lead and mercury which leach into ground water aquifers and surface water sources, harming humans and wildlife.

797F. 797F, the latest model of 797 class dump trucks manufactured and developed by , is the second-biggest mining dump truck in the world.The truck has been in service since 2009. It can carry 400t of payload compared to its predecessor models 797B and the first generation 797, with payload capacities of 380t and 360t respectively.

The Kiruna mine, located in Lapland, is the largest and most modern underground iron ore mine in the world, managed by the Swedish mining company Luossavaara-Kiirunavaara AB. The Kiruna mine, with its underground jaw crusher, has an ore body 2.5 miles long, 260 ft to 390 ft thick and reaching a depth of up to 1.2 miles.

The British and Tasmanian Charcoal Iron Company (BTCIC) was an iron mining and smelting company that operated from 1874 to 1878 in Northern Tasmania, Australia. It was formed by floating the operations of a private company, the Tasmanian Charcoal Iron Company that operated between 1871 and 1874.
